Canon PowerShot D10The PowerShot D10 is Canon’s first attempt at a take-everywhere, do-everything camera, and they’ve certainly taken a different approach to the likes of Olympus. The Canon D10 has a rounded, almost toy-camera-like styling, with the option of changing the front fascia adding some individuality (although this camouflage model might not be to most people’s tastes).
